Maharashtra: Cheating complaint lodged against Uddhav Thackeray for ‘betraying’ voters

Accusing the Sena of abandoning voters and their ideology in the greed for power, Chaure said that the party had cheated his family who had voted for them.

Amidst all the drama in Maharashtra over government formation, a man named Ratnakar Chaure, hailing from the Aurangabad district has lodged a complaint with Begampura police station against Shiv Sena chief Uddhav Thackeray, along with MLAs Pradeep Jaiswal and Chandrakant Khaire accusing them of cheating him and his family.

According to a New18 Hindi report, Chaure, in his written complaint, has said that he and his family had voted for the BJP-Shiv Sena alliance in the Maharastra Assembly elections. He furthered that Shiv Sena had during election campaign asked for votes in the pretext of forming a coalition government with BJP which would safeguard Hindutva. Now, Shiv Sena, in its greed for power, abandoned both, the alliance as well as its ideologies. Chaure said that the party had cheated his family who had voted for them.
